Explanation

  • T-lymphocytes (T-cells) are a type of white blood cell essential for adaptive immunity.
  • They originate from hematopoietic stem cells in the bone marrow as progenitor cells.
  • These progenitor T-cells then migrate to the thymus gland to undergo a complex process of maturation and selection.
  • In the thymus, T-cells learn to recognize foreign antigens while remaining tolerant to the body's own tissues (self-antigens). This process is called thymic education.
  • The 'T' in T-cell specifically stands for 'thymus-derived', indicating its site of maturation.

Why Other Options Were Wrong

  • Option B: The liver's primary functions are metabolic and detoxification. While it is a site of hematopoiesis during fetal life, it is not the location for T-cell maturation after birth.
  • Option C: The spleen is a secondary lymphoid organ where mature lymphocytes are activated to respond to blood-borne pathogens. It filters blood but does not mature T-cells.
  • Option D: The kidneys are excretory organs responsible for filtering waste from the blood and regulating fluid and electrolyte balance. They have no role in the immune system's cell maturation processes.

Clinical Relevance

  • Understanding the thymus's role is crucial for recognizing immunodeficiency disorders like DiGeorge syndrome, where congenital absence or underdevelopment of the thymus leads to a severe lack of functional T-cells.
  • The thymus naturally shrinks with age (thymic involution), leading to a reduced output of new T-cells. This process, known as immunosenescence, contributes to the increased susceptibility of the elderly to new infections and a reduced response to vaccines.
  • What if? - If the question asked where B-cells mature, the correct answer would be the bone marrow. Both B and T cells originate in the bone marrow, but only B-cells complete their maturation there.
How to Approach the Question
  • This is a factual recall question testing knowledge of the immune system.
  • First, identify the key terms in the question: 'T-cells' and 'mature'.
  • Recall the primary lymphoid organs, which are the sites of lymphocyte development and maturation. These are the bone marrow and the thymus.
  • Remember the mnemonic that the 'T' in T-cell stands for 'Thymus', indicating its maturation site.
  • Contrast this with B-cells, where the 'B' stands for 'Bone marrow' (in mammals), its site of origin and maturation.
  • Evaluate the given options: The liver, spleen, and kidney are not primary lymphoid organs responsible for T-cell maturation.
